Retrospective study of porcine circovirus type 2 infection reveals a novel genotype PCV2f.
Transboundary and emerging diseases - 1 Apr 2018
Bao F, Mi S, Luo Q, Guo H, Tu C, Zhu G, Gong W
Abstract excerpt
Porcine postweaning multisystemic wasting syndrome (PMWS) caused by porcine circovirus type 2 (PCV2) is a disease causing severe economic losses annually worldwide to the pig industry. PCV2 infection was first reported in China in 2000, and currently has three major genotypes, PCV2a, b and d, circulating in this country. To further elucidate the origin and prevalence of PCV2 in China, 123 clinical pig tissue...
